Output db95e3790e47a833a532c29a1f4f82caff9676c1da4f4f8c073bae3b7a13f6b0:30

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375252167ce10d7a5e3769730dff07611a3c0 OP_EQUAL
address
3BMEXR71g6AKgsCf3eLaHa739fEgLZKqNf
transaction
db95e3790e47a833a532c29a1f4f82caff9676c1da4f4f8c073bae3b7a13f6b0
confirmations
280682
spent
true